Technical Specifications

  • Brand: Genware
  • SKU: GE208
  • Material: Aluminium (Blade) & Rubber Wood (Handle)
  • Blade Dimensions: 305(W) x 355(D) mm (12" x 14")
  • Overall Length: 660mm (26")
  • Weight: 0.6kg
  • Colour: Silver & Natural Wood

Installation and  Maintenance Guide

Getting Started

  • Before first use, wash the aluminium blade with warm, soapy water and  dry thoroughly.
  • Check the handle is securely fitted to the blade head.
  • For best results, lightly season the wooden handle with a food-safe mineral oil to protect it.
  • Always 'flour' the peel lightly before placing dough on it to ensure a non-stick launch.

Keeping It in Top Shape

  • Clean the peel by hand after each use; do not place it in a commercial dishwasher as this will damage the wooden handle.
  • Use a non-abrasive sponge on the aluminium blade to avoid scratches.
  • Store the peel by hanging it in a dry, well-ventilated area to protect both the wood and  metal.
  • Periodically re-apply food-safe mineral oil to the handle to prevent it from drying out and  cracking.

Buying Guide: Choosing the Right Pizza Peel

Not sure which peel is perfect for your pizzeria? Here are a few things to consider to make sure you get the right tool for the job.

Blade Material

Aluminium (like this one) is lightweight, durable, and  offers a super-smooth surface. Wood looks traditional but can be heavier and  harder to clean. Stainless steel is very durable but often the heaviest option.

Handle Length

Choose a length that allows you to reach the back of your oven comfortably without getting too close to the heat. Longer handles are essential for deep deck ovens and  wood-fired ovens.

Blade Size & Shape

The head of the peel should be slightly larger than the pizzas you make. A square head is great for general use, while a round head is often preferred for turning pizzas inside the oven.

Solid vs. Perforated

Solid blades (like this one) provide a stable surface for assembling and  launching pizzas. Perforated blades allow excess flour to fall away and  can reduce friction, but are often more expensive.

Handle Grip

Wood provides a classic, cool-touch grip. Some modern peels use composite or metal handles, which can be more durable but may get hot if not properly designed.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How do I stop my pizza dough from sticking to the peel?

A: The key is a light dusting of flour or semolina on the blade before you place the raw dough on it. Don't let a wet dough sit on the peel for too long before launching it into the oven.

Q: Can this aluminium pizza peel with wooden handle be used in a very hot, wood-fired oven?

A: Absolutely. The long wooden handle is designed to keep you at a safe distance, and  the aluminium blade can withstand extremely high temperatures found in commercial pizza ovens.

Q: Is this peel dishwasher safe?

A: No. The high heat and  harsh detergents in a dishwasher will damage and  warp the wooden handle. It should always be washed by hand.

Q: What's the main advantage of an aluminium blade over a wooden one?

A: Aluminium blades are thinner, lighter, and  much easier to clean and  maintain. They provide a smoother surface for launching pizzas, reducing the chance of the dough sticking.

Q: Is the handle on the Genware GE208 pizza peel replaceable?

A: The tubular handle is securely fixed to the blade for maximum stability and  is not designed to be replaced.

Q: Is this a 'placing' peel or a 'turning' peel?

A: This is primarily a placing peel, designed with a larger head for building and  launching pizzas. Turning peels are typically smaller and  rounder for manoeuvring the pizza inside the oven.

Q: How heavy is it? Is it suitable for a long shift?

A: It's very lightweight at just 0.6kg. This design helps to minimise arm and  shoulder strain for pizzaiolos working long, busy services.

Q: How do I clean the aluminium blade properly?

A: Simply use warm soapy water and  a soft cloth or sponge. Avoid using abrasive scourers which could scratch the surface.

Why an Aluminium Blade Gives You the Edge

Ever wonder why so many pros favour an aluminium pizza peel? It's all about a clean launch. Think of it like this: a wooden peel is like trying to slide a piece of paper off a carpet – there's friction, and  things can easily catch and  snag. An aluminium blade, however, is like sliding that same paper across a polished table. With a light dusting of flour, the raw pizza dough glides effortlessly off the surface and  into the oven. This smoothness is crucial for maintaining the pizza's shape and  preventing toppings from shifting, giving you a perfect result every time without the sticking and  tearing common with worn wooden peels.
